Whether you're looking to build trust, set the tone, or make a visible impact, this episode is your tactical roadmap for the next stretch of your leadership journey.5 KEY TAKEAWAYS:1. Own the narrative. Reintroduce your role and clarify your priorities. A simple team meeting or summary email can realign expectations and build trust.2. Systematize your influence. Create consistent rhythms—like weekly updates or structured decision-making forums—that make your impact visible and predictable.3. Choose one high-impact initiative. Show you can move the needle by simplifying a stuck process or streamlining a workflow that affects more than just your team.4. Deepen strategic relationships. Go beyond “getting to know you” chats. Book second-round meetings that explore strategy and surface valuable early feedback.5. Protect your energy. Leadership presence starts with how you feel. Schedule personal time first, and build in moments that recharge and ground you.“Your energy is part of your presence. If you are exhausted, distracted, reactive—that is what people experience.” – Karen GombaultThe 90-day mark is where perceptions form and expectations rise. Questions We Answer in This Episode: [00:05:15] What does perimenopause look like for asymptomatic women over 50? [00:20:00] What changes do we need to make to our workout routine? [00:25:00] If asymptomatic, how do we know if we're moving through the stages and how then do we judge what changes to make? What's Showing Up for Abby? Gaining 20 lbs slowly post-kids, despite a healthy lifestyle. Feeling frustrated when traditional diet and exercise weren't effective anymore. Friends telling you might be “doing too much” in terms of fitness. 5 days/week strength training Seasonal long-distance running (up to 30K) Uses YouTube programs with fast-paced, minimal-rest formats Occasional yoga/mobility work Exercises to failure, prefers lifting heavy Time to Flip the Switch with Abby: Overtraining & Recovery Benefit from less frequent but heavier strength sessions Incorporating rest + slower tempo lifting could help. Recovery may be insufficient—without it, muscle building stalls. Running & Cortisol Long runs + strength + possible fasting = cortisol overload. Midlife women are more vulnerable to stress and hormonal shifts. Lower estrogen increases cortisol response, impacting body composition. Sleep & Metabolism Sleep deprivation is linked to stubborn weight and reduced muscle recovery. Abby averages 5.5–6.5 hours of sleep, with limited REM/deep sleep. Need more sleep to trigger growth hormone/testosterone release. Supplements Try specific forms (glycinate or L-threonate) and gradually increase the dose. Abby uses magnesium oil and a multivitamin with magnesium. Nutrition A little caloric deficit is okay, but eat enough. Not doing it too long creates stress. Reintroduce sweet potatoes. Carbs with high fiber at night will help us sleep better. Key Takeaways to Know Is This Perimenopause? You might be in perimenopause without classic symptoms: Weight gain and sleep disruption can be early signs. More isn't always better in midlife exercise: Volume should decrease, intensity (with recovery) can rise. Muscle preservation is crucial: It drives metabolism and health outcomes more than weight alone. Sleep matters just as much as workouts: It affects hormonal balance, recovery, and fat loss. Cortisol and insulin sensitivity shift in midlife: Long-distance cardio and fasting a tricky combo. Smart scale stats are more telling than BMI: Body composition paints a clearer health picture. Personalized magnesium dosing: May improve sleep and aid recovery in midlife. Key Takeaways: Thoughts as Habits: Most of our thoughts are habitual patterns developed to solve emotional discomfort. Your brain is constantly seeking control and certainty, often at the expense of creativity and emotional balance. The Brain's Narrative: Thought processes aim to regulate your nervous system by telling a story that makes you feel safe. These narratives, while comforting, can sometimes keep you in a stress loop. Burnout and Creativity: Chronic stress, often self-inflicted by overworking or overthinking, depletes creativity and leaves you feeling stuck. Small habits like reading, exercise, or mindfulness breaks can help shift you into a more relaxed and creative state. Breaking the Cycle: Identify the problem your brain is trying to solve and examine the emotion driving it. Ask yourself, "Is this thought process leading to a regulated nervous system, or is it just a hamster wheel?" Reintroduce simple, grounding habits that support balance and mental clarity. Action Steps: Pause and Reflect: Notice your thought patterns and ask, "What emotional need is my brain trying to solve?" Interrupt the Hamster Wheel: Step outside the loop of habitual thinking and assess whether your current actions are helping or hindering your emotional well-being. Start Small: Set a micro-goal to reintroduce a habit that supports creativity and calm, like reading for 10 minutes, taking a phone-free break, or practicing deep breathing. Be Patient: Building new habits takes time. Celebrate small wins and trust that your efforts will compound over time. Send us a textJoin us on the Vibrant Wellness Podcast as Dr. Pedi Mirdamadi shares how his journey from competitive fitness to naturopathic medicine reshaped his understanding of health. With a background in psychology, kinesiology, and functional medicine—and mentorship under cardiologist Dr. Mimi Guarneri—Dr. Pedi focuses on preventive strategies in digestive health, hormonal balance, and cardiovascular wellness.In this episode, Dr. Pedi dives into the critical link between gut health and overall well-being. He explains how diet impacts not only physical health but also brain function, immunity, and even genetic expression. Through tools like food sensitivity testing and the 4R protocol (Remove, Replace, Reintroduce, Repair), he offers actionable steps for managing conditions like IBS and SIBO. You'll learn why personalized nutrition and stress management are essential for gut health.Dr. Pedi also explores the powerful connection between the nervous system and digestion. Chronic stress disrupts digestion, but calming practices can activate the "rest and digest" state, improving both gut and metabolic health. (Amazon affiliate link). Takeaways Avoiding toxins and allergenic ingredients in everyday products is important for overall health and well-being. There is a difference between irritants and allergens, and understanding this distinction can help in identifying and avoiding potential skin reactions. Fragrances, both natural and synthetic, can be a common cause of allergic contact dermatitis. Finding skincare products that work for sensitive skin can be challenging, and it often requires trial and error. The beauty industry needs more research, regulation, and education to ensure the safety and efficacy of products. Simplify your skincare routine and eliminate potential irritants to identify triggers for skin reactions. Reintroduce products one at a time to pinpoint the cause of skin problems. Skincare for young children should involve minimal washing and exposure to some dirt. Excessive cleanliness can disrupt the immune system and the skin's natural balance. Fragrance and essential oils are common culprits for skin reactions and should be approached with caution. Regulations in the skincare industry need to prioritize transparency and provide options for fragrance-free products.
